sexta-feira, julho 22, 2005

SCP - transferir arquivos de forma segura

Se você tem um arquivo em sua maquina e deseja transferir para outra maquina, ou mesmo um outro servidor, utilize o "scp".
Você não precisa instalar ele, pois ele vem com o ssh.

Sintaxe:
scp seu_login@host_remoto:/algun/diretorio/arquivo_remoto

/algun/dir/arquivo_local

admin01# scp rfilippus@192.168.200.200:/home/rfilippus/confs/squid.conf /usr/local/etc

[]'s

quinta-feira, julho 21, 2005

Como montar compartilhamentos do Samba no FreeBSD 5.4 e RedHat Linux 3

FreeBSD 5.4-RELEASE
==============

Primeiro eu precisei carregar um modulo:
admin01# kldunload /boot/kernel/smbfs.ko

Agore crie um local onde você pretende montar/mapear o compartilhamento:
admin01# mkdir /mnt/serversamba

Agora monte o compartilhamento:
admin01# mount_smbfs //usuario@servidor/compartilhamento /mnt/serversamba

Problemas:
Se você usar um IP em vez de host no campo servidor, ele poderá mostrar o seguinte erro:
mount_smbfs: can't get server address: syserr = Operation timed ou

Então use o host(nome da maquina) no lugar de IP.
Caso ele não ache o host, insira no /etc/hosts o seguinte:

admin01# cat >> /etc/hosts
192.168.200.200 servidorsamba

Onde: servidorsamba é o nome de seu servidor.


Red Hat Linux 3.4.x
=============

Os passos são os mesmos, apenas mude o comando para:

mount -t smbfs -o username=usuario //servidor/compartilhamento /mnt/serversamba

OBS: no Red Hat não tem a opção de carregar o modulo para smbfs.
Mas ele não ira achar o ip também, então adicione no /etc/hosts.


Duvidas, coloquem seus comentarios que responderei.

quarta-feira, julho 20, 2005

Procura mais de uma palavra em uma saida de dados.

Exemplo:

Quero procurar dois processos no ps, o smbd e o nmbd:

# ps -ax egrep 'smbd nmbd'

Resultado:
34272 ?? Is 0:00.00 /usr/local/sbin/smbd -D -s /usr/local/etc/smb.conf
34274 ?? I 0:00.00 /usr/local/sbin/smbd -D -s /usr/local/etc/smb.conf

[]´s